Understanding Diabetes and its Symptoms:
Diabetes is a condition in which the body is unable to properly process glucose, or sugar, in the bloodstream. This can lead to high levels of glucose in the blood, which can cause a range of health problems if left untreated.
Common symptoms of diabetes include:
• Frequent urination
• Increased thirst
• Fatigue
• Blurred vision
• Slow healing of cuts and wounds
• Tingling or numbness in the hands and feet
• If you are experiencing any of these symptoms, it is important to see a healthcare provider for diagnosis and treatment.
